Pandan Coconut Chia Pudding

A delightful and nutritious chia pudding infused with the aromatic flavor of pandan leaves, perfect for a healthy breakfast or snack.

Ingredients
  • 1 cup coconut milk
  • 1/4 cup chia seeds
  • 2 pandan leaves, tied in a knot
  • 2 tablespoons honey or maple syrup
  • 1/2 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• Fresh fruits for topping
Instructions
  1. In a saucepan, combine coconut milk, pandan leaves, and sweetener. Heat gently until warm but not boiling.
  2. Remove from heat, add chia seeds and vanilla extract, and stir well.
  3. Let it sit for 10 minutes, then stir again and refrigerate for at least 2 hours or overnight. Serve topped with fresh fruits.

Pandan Rice with Grilled Chicken

A fragrant pandan-infused rice dish paired with succulent grilled chicken, making for a wholesome meal.

Ingredients
  • 1 cup jasmine rice
  • 2 pandan leaves, tied in a knot
  • 2 cups water
  • 2 chicken breasts
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• Salt and pepper to taste
Instructions
  1. In a pot, combine jasmine rice, pandan leaves, and water. Bring to a boil, then reduce heat and simmer until rice is cooked.
  2. Meanwhile, marinate chicken breasts with olive oil, salt, and pepper, then grill until cooked through.
  3. Serve grilled chicken over pandan rice for a flavorful meal.

Pandan Leaf Herbal Tea

A soothing herbal tea made from fresh pandan leaves, known for its aromatic flavor and health benefits.

Ingredients
  • 5 pandan leaves, cut into pieces
  • 4 cups water
  • Honey or lemon to taste
Instructions
  1. Boil water in a pot and add the cut pandan leaves.
  2. Simmer for 10-15 minutes, then strain the leaves out.
  3. Serve hot with honey or lemon for added flavor.

Pandan Leaf Coconut Rice Pudding

A creamy and comforting rice pudding infused with pandan leaves and coconut milk, perfect for dessert.

Ingredients
  • 1 cup jasmine rice
  • 2 cups coconut milk
  • 2 pandan leaves, tied in a knot
  • 1/4 cup sugar
  • Pinch of salt
Instructions
  1. In a pot, combine jasmine rice, coconut milk, pandan leaves, sugar, and salt.
  2. Cook over medium heat, stirring occasionally, until rice is tender and mixture thickens.
  3. Remove pandan leaves, serve warm or chilled, and enjoy.
